Functional Description ? help Back to Top
Source Description
UniProtTranscriptional activator involved in the sporophytic control of cell wall patterning and gametophytic control of pollen development. May play a role in the control of metabolic pathways regulating cellular transport and lipid metabolism. {ECO:0000269|PubMed:17719007, ECO:0000269|PubMed:19449183}.
